Verdict

The Jim Bolger-trained Clongowes, consistent and gutsy, will possibly try and make all here from stall 13, but he may have to make way for Irish Cesarewitch winner, LAWS OF SPIN, who boasts some fancy entries for the end of the season.
  1. Laws Of Spin
  2. Clongowes
  3. Aydoun
